Output 8866ab422dc73198d8e378afa64b2865070713bfd0e949664ec65bb3468d7631:0

value
421996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6eb573198843452296962fa963d025e0ef76cfb1 OP_EQUAL
address
3BnPcz5VEX3ENfLMaD9fp21zQvc8HvbgzR
transaction
8866ab422dc73198d8e378afa64b2865070713bfd0e949664ec65bb3468d7631
spent
true